How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 92082?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
92082 Studio Apartments | $1,772 | $1,593 | $1,945 |
92082 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,450 | $1,453 | $3,685 |
92082 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,858 | $1,720 | $13,050 |
92082 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,012 | $2,595 | $6,750 |
92082 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,275 | $4,650 | $5,900 |
